Cement block rep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ated concrete blocks that form the foundation, walls, or structures of a property. Over time, exposure to the elements, settling, or age can cause blocks to crack, crumble, or shift out of place.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ques and materials to restore the integrity of the blocks, ensuring they are stable and secure. Proper repair not only improves the appearance of the property but also helps maintain its structural safety and longevity.
This service addresses common problems such as cracked or crumbling blocks, gaps between blocks, and bowing or leaning walls. These issues can lead to water intrusion, pest entry, or further structural damage if left unaddressed. Repairing or replacing damaged blocks can prevent more costly repairs down the line and enhance the overall stability of the property. The overview below groups typical Cement Block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Middleburg,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ement block repairs in Middleburg range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as patching cracks or replacing small sections,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end unless additional work is needed.
Moderate Repairs - Larger, more involved repairs, including rebuilding sections of a wall or addressing significant damage,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king durable, long-term solutions.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ire section or wall of cement blocks can range from $1,500 to $5,000 or more, depending on size and complexity. Most full replacements in the area tend to fall into the middle of this range, with larger projects reaching higher costs.
Complex or Custom Projects - Highly intricate repairs or custom masonry work can exceed $5,000, especially for large or specialized structures. Such projects are less common but may be necessary for extensive restoration or aesthetic enhancements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can cement block repairs address? Local contractors can handle issues like cracks, crumbling mortar, and broken or shifted blocks to restore structural integrity and appearance.
How do professionals typically repair damaged cement blocks? Repair methods often include patching cracks, replacing broken blocks, and repointing mortar joints to ensure stability and durability.
Are there different repair options for various types of cement block damage? Yes, service providers can recommend suitable solutions based on the extent and nature of the damage, such as sealing cracks or replacing entire blocks if necessary.
What signs indicate that cement blocks may need repair? Visible cracks, crumbling mortar, leaning or shifted blocks, and water infiltration are common indicators that repairs might be needed.
